More than six decades after its first day of launch, this famous cartoon brand continues to return to the big screen this summer with the movie "Chi trum" 2025, scheduled to premiere from July 18, 2025.
Born in 1958 by Belgian painter Peyo (real name Pierre Culliford), he was originally a supporting character in the collection of short stories Johann and Peewit published in spirou magazine. However, the enthusiastic love of readers has brought the blue-skinned characters to the mainstream.
In 1981, Hanna-Barbera - famous for Tom & Jerry - brought "Chi Trump" to American television through a series of cartoons with many episodes broadcast on NBC, lasting for 9 seasons and winning the prestigious Emmy award.
Not only that, the works "Chi trum" also send a message of environmental protection - the whole village living in the green forest always considers nature as a roof that needs to be preserved. Since 2017, "Chi trum" has accompanied the United Nations in the "Small Smurfs Big Goals" campaign to encourage children to achieve 17 sustainable development goals.
